Big Bomb Shelter From the Soviet Past

2013/11/06



This big factory shelter has an unusual layout, numerous hermetic doors which are not so typical for shelters of such type. It belonged to a defense plant founded in 1968 as “Rostov telephone factory”. Under cover of telephone communications production the factory assembled internal components of long-range missiles (various chips and others). After the collapse of the USSR the factory began to undergo serious losses.
